President Donald Trump’s newly announced national crypto reserve made headlines fast, and not just because it included big-name tokens like Solana and Cardano. The real chatter started when XRP showed up on the list, kicking off a swirl of speculation about how it got there and whether lobbying had anything to do with it. Insiders say the Trump XRP inclusion wasn’t fully vetted, and the former president felt blindsided once he learned Ripple-linked players were involved.It was meant to be a forward-looking crypto initiative. Instead, it’s raising questions about how digital assets end up in government strategies and who gets a say behind the scenes.The RolloutOn March 2, Trump unveiled plans for a U.S. strategic crypto reserve on his social platform. XRP, SOL, and ADA were named as part of the basket. XRP climbed about 5 percent, hitting $2.29. Traders seemed excited by the perceived government nod, until reports emerged that one of the coin’s biggest backers might have helped shape the announcement.Trump XRP Drama: Ripple and the Lobbying AngleAccording to Politico, a staffer from a lobbying firm tied to Ripple Labs reportedly drafted part of the original message announcing the crypto reserve. If true, that would mean XRP didn’t just earn its spot, it might have been suggested directly by someone with a stake in the game. He reportedly cut ties with the lobbyist and made clear that they would no longer participate in anything related to the administration’s crypto plans.Ripple’s Political ReachRipple Labs has had a visible presence in political circles for some time now. Its Chief Legal Officer, Stuart Alderoty, donated over $300,000 to Trump-aligned PACs during the 2024 campaign. Ripple also gave $5 million worth of XRP to the inaugural fund and has been backing Fairshake, a PAC that supports crypto-friendly candidates from both parties.To be clear, none of this is illegal. Political contributions and lobbying are common in Washington.
